Gold Medal for Cultural Merit to the magazine ‘L’Avenç’

In 1976, a group of historians published the first issue of a publication which right from the outset would become a point of reference for social, history and academic spheres. Having just published issue number 500, the last to be printed as a hard copy, ‘L’Avenç’ receives recognition from the city for its leading role in the development of Barcelona’s cultural and academic fabric over the course of nearly fifty years.

Over the course of 46 years, L’Avenç has included articles by the likes of Josep Fontana, Ferran Mascarell, Carmen Isasa, Antoni Castel, Núria Santamaria, Jordi Puntí and many others. The pages of the magazine offer readers a critical look at cultural activity, a chance to broaden their knowledge of history, literature and art, discover important people through hundreds of interviews and get a better understanding of Barcelona and Catalonia in the last quarter of the 20th century and first quarter of the 21st century.

The publication also stands out for its role as a book publisher for various generations of historians and writers.
